Many users on Instagram are seeing a gray tick on their account. Many questions are now being raised about this gray tick. Many users have also claimed that due to the gray tick, their accounts are not getting the reach they used to and the reels they share are getting less views than before. Many Instagram users are seeing a light gray checkmark i.e. gray tick next to their username on their profile. This is a kind of Instagram prompt. This means that your account is considered eligible for Meta Verified subscription.
By tapping on this gray tick next to the username, you will see the Meta Verified option in front of you. From here you can start the process of purchasing a paid subscription. After purchasing the subscription you will receive a normal blue verified badge. Specially, your followers will not see this gray tick on your account. The gray tick on the account can only be seen by users who have this account login.
Many users have claimed that the reach of their accounts has become less than before due to the gray tick. It has also been claimed that the reels and posts of users who have received a gray tick are getting less views than before. So the users are very shocked due to this gray tick. However, Instagram has not yet shared any information about whether there is any relationship between the gray tick and the reach of the account and the view of the reels.
